*,*:after,*:before{box-sizing:border-box;transition:all ease .35s}html{color:#f9f3f3;font-size:1em;line-height:1.5}body{font-family:Outfit,sans-serif;background:url(../../../img/background.jpg) bottom left no-repeat;background-size:cover;min-height:100vh;width:100%;margin:0}.navbar{display:flex;justify-content:space-between;align-items:center}.logo{height:40px}main{display:flex;justify-content:center;align-items:center;text-align:center;height:80vh;text-shadow:0px 4px 4px rgba(0,0,0,.25)}h1{font-weight:400}h2{font-size:4em;font-weight:500;line-height:1;margin-top:16px}.container{max-width:1140px;width:100%;padding:1em;margin:0 auto}.radial{background:radial-gradient(50% 50% at 50% 50%,#fac438cc,#fff0)}.btn{display:flex;align-items:center;background:#fac438;font-weight:500;line-height:40px;color:#3e2f08;text-decoration:none;width:max-content;gap:.5em;border-radius:.5em;padding:.5em .75em}.btn:hover{background-color:#e2ab22}.btn-lg{font-size:2em;line-height:1;margin:0 auto}.btn-sm{font-size:1em;line-height:1}.apps-info{font-size:1.25em;margin-top:4em}::-moz-selection{background:#b3d4fc;text-shadow:none}::selection{background:#b3d4fc;text-shadow:none}img,svg{vertical-align:middle}footer{font-size:1.25em;font-weight:100;background:#321d11;color:#faf6ee;gap:16px;padding:3em}h4{margin:.825em 0 .5em}.footer-content{display:grid;grid-auto-flow:column;gap:2em}.platforms{display:inline-block;margin-bottom:1em}.socials{display:flex;gap:1em;margin:1em 0 0;margin-block-start:0;padding:0}li{list-style-type:none}@media (max-width: 37.5em){body{background:url(../../../img/background.jpg) center center no-repeat;background-size:cover}.footer-content{display:grid;grid-auto-flow:row;gap:1em}}
